Data is stored in either CSV files or one of the following database management systems: M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QLite, or Microsoft Access.
1 2 | install(dataset, connection, db_file = NULL, conn_file = NULL,
data_dir = ".", log_dir = NULL)
|
dataset |
the name of the dataset that you wish to download |
connection |
what type of database connection should be used. The options include: mysql, postgres, sqlite, msaccess, or csv' |
db_file |
the name of the datbase file the dataset should be loaded into |
conn_file |
the path to the .conn file that contains the connection configuration options for mysql and postgres databases. This defaults to mysql.conn or postgres.conn respectively. The connection file is a comma seperated file with four fields: user, password, host, and port. |
data_dir |
the location where the dataset should be installed. Only relevant for csv connection types. Defaults to current working directory |
log_dir |
the location where the retriever log should be stored if the progress is not printed to the console |
